Any ideas why a Nikon 300 AF S would stop auto focusing? Removing it from the body then reattaching makes it work again. This is the problem described on one that's for sale. Supposed to have been happening on a D50 body. Thanks.
 
Hard to say in this particular instance. Every time I've had a similar problem the usual culprits were dirty electrical contacts. On one very rare occasion the rear mounting ring of the lens was loose - easy fix for both circumstances. I'm not saying that is what is wrong in your case. You'll have to figure that out for yourself or with the help of someone and with the actual physical lens in your hands.
